(UPDATED) Maintenance Screen: New Feature to Adjust Size/Scaling Note: an additional note has been included regarding the resolution limitations. A new feature has been added to the Maintenance screen in PointCare so that users can adjust the screen size/resolution, much like can be done on a computer desktop. ENH#CC36848 To access this new feature, go to Maintenance->Settings: Display/Font Scaling

A slider control allows the user to define a resolution between 1.0 and 3.0 on their device. Simply drag the slider control to decrease or increase the resolution and notice how the screen changes. Below are examples of this devices screen shown at 1.0, 2.0 and 3.0 density.

Upon changing the resolution and tapping the Back menu, the user will be presented with the Save/Discard Changes dialog followed by another dialog asking them to restart PointCare for the changes to properly take effect.

Tapping the Restart Now button will proceed to automatically restart PointCare.

If the Restart Later option is selected, an additional message indicates that some screens may not display

Upon restarting PointCare and successfully logging back in to the application, the user will be prompted with a message after 15 seconds asking to verify their changes or revert to the system default values. This message will automatically choose to revert in 30 seconds.

Based on the user selection to the above message, this will either trigger the end of the process to revert to the system default or keep the selected size if user is happy with the resolution change.

While each user will have their preferences for their specific device, the following ranges are recommended for optimal viewing. Update on 8/24/12: We have attempted to correct most of the issues above for our August release to production. However, an issue was discovered on Android devices with an operating system of 3.0 or greater where increasing the font size causes some tool bars to lose functions or truncate buttons. Here is an example where the toolbars Cut button truncates and the Paste button disappears when in portrait mode. This issue is scheduled to be fixed in our December release.

In the meantime, switching the device to Landscape mode can alleviate the issue which allows for more functions to show on the tool bar than when in portrait mode. Reducing the font size can also alleviate the issue.
